In the vibrant tapestry of South Indian modernism, few threads are as delicate yet enduring as those woven by k r harie. Born in Chennai in 1941, Harie emerged from a period of profound cultural transition, where the ancient echoes of Indian tradition met the burgeoning waves of global modernism. His journey was not merely one of personal discovery but a fundamental contribution to the Cholamandal Artists' Village, an experimental commune that redefined the artistic landscape of Tamil Nadu. While his early explorations led him through the rich, textured world of oil paintings, it was in the disciplined, rhythmic precision of pen and ink that he truly found his voice, transforming simple lines into profound meditations on existence.
The essence of Harie’s mastery lies in his ability to command the void. As a founding member of the Cholamandal movement, he embraced an ethos that sought to bridge the gap between fine art and traditional craft, fostering a community where innovation was rooted in local identity. This duality is palpable in his technique; though his medium was often monochromatic, his work breathed with a spectrum of tonal gradations. He possessed a rare ability to use subtle shading and meticulous linework to create an illusion of depth, turning a flat surface into a window overlooking rugged, atmospheric terrains. His development as an artist was a continuous dialogue between the structured discipline of his training and a spontaneous, emotive response to the natural world.
Perhaps the most poignant testament to Harie’s artistic soul is found in his celebrated “Rock Series,” conceived in 2009. In these works, the artist moves away from the broader narratives of landscape to focus on the intimate, silent textures of the earth. These drawings are masterclasses in atmospheric perspective, where the ruggedness of stone and the starkness of terrain are rendered with such precision that one can almost feel the coolness of the shadows. Within these desolate, beautiful landscapes, Harie often placed a single, solitary bird—a recurring motif that serves as a powerful symbol of resilience, contemplation, and the quiet strength found in isolation.
The significance of this series extends beyond mere technical skill; it represents a philosophical culmination of his life's work. Through the interplay of light and dark, Harie captures the tension between permanence and transience. The rocks stand as eternal witnesses to time, while the bird represents the fleeting, delicate nature of life. This thematic depth, achieved through the humble medium of ink, elevates his drawings from mere topographical studies to profound poetic expressions of the human condition.
The historical importance of k r harie cannot be overstated when considering the trajectory of the Madras Movement of Art. By participating in the foundational years of Cholamandal, he helped establish a precedent for artist-driven collectives that could sustain themselves through both creativity and communal effort. His work remains a vital link in the evolution of Indian landscape art, proving that modernism does not require the abandonment of one's roots, but rather a deeper, more nuanced way of looking at them.
Today, Harie is remembered not just as a master of the line, but as a pioneer who navigated the complexities of identity in a post-colonial era. His ability to synthesize classical influences with contemporary sensibilities left an indelible mark on the art of Tamil Nadu and beyond.
